Where is the nearest train station to Melilla in Morocco?
A train station was built in 2009 just at the borderline with Morocco in the city of Nador a couple miles from Melilla. The train connects with Moroccan rail system that goes to the south and the north of the country.
You can take the train from Tangier to Nador in 10 hours to go to Melilla.

What is the closest country to lanzarote?
Lanzarote is one of the Canary Islands and is located about 140 km off the coast of Morocco.

What do Sunni Muslims in Morocco teach?
There are very few functional differences between Sunni Islam in any country. Even between the four major schools, the differences concern very specific issues (such as whether you need to wash your hands once or twice before prayer). As a result, Moroccan Sunnis (who are >99% of the country), teach most of the same things as Sunnis elsewhere.
Morocco's much more mild religious climate, however, makes Moroccans, generally speaking, more Westernized and liberal in their outlook. Salafism and Islamism are both condemned by the Royal Government and by common-folk. Religion is seen as a personal choice in Morocco to a much higher degree than most places in the Arab World.
